Do I need consent when traveling with my child?
Consent typically needed when traveling with one parent or when child travels alone. Check destination country requirements.
What if the other parent refuses to give consent?
You may need court order or legal intervention. Consult family law attorney.
How long is a consent letter valid?
Validity varies. Some countries require consent letter dated within specific period (e.g., 6 months). Check requirements.
Do I need consent for domestic travel?
Generally no, but check airline and country requirements.
What if I have sole custody?
Provide court order or custody documents showing sole custody.
Can I use the same consent letter for multiple trips?
Some countries accept consent letters for multiple trips within validity period. Check requirements.
What if my child has a different surname?
Provide additional documentation showing relationship (birth certificate, marriage certificate).
Do I need consent for school trips?
Yes, typically need consent from parents for school trips.
What if I can't contact the other parent?
You may need court order or legal intervention. Consult family law attorney.
How much does it cost to notarize a consent letter?
Costs vary by notary and location, typically ZAR 100-500.
